Greek side Panathinakos have begun their transfer market activity by selling Brazilian striker Rodrigo Souza to Corinthians. This was announced on the club’s official website.
Souza joined the Athens outfit from Flamengo this summer but hasn’t been able to impress manager Henk ten Cate, who tends to use Vaggelis Mantzios for the position.
Panathinaikos are expected to make a few changes during the transfer window, particularly in order to prepare for the Champions League knock-out phase. The departure of Souza frees up a valuable non-EU spot.
Souza and Corinthians have agreed on a three-year deal
